Stanley M. Pease, 67, lifetime Ellensburg resident, died Friday night at Royal Vista Care Center, where he had lived since 1967. He was born in Ellensburg on September 10, 1919, a son of Carmi and Addie (Bruce) Pease.
He attended Ellensburg schools and was employed in the early days by Mr. and Mrs. Gust Carras at the Valley Cafe. He was a member of the Bethel Gospel Church.
He is survived by a sister, Anne Crowther of Ellensburg and a brother Carmi Pease of Vancouver, Washington.
Funeral will be 11 a.m., Wednesday at Cotton Chapel. The Rev. Robert Cousart will officiate. Following cremation, inurnment will be in the family plot at the IOOF Cemetery.
Ellensburg Daily Record, September 16, 1986
